So how to all of these pieces fit together? In as many ways as you like, really. But here’s how Kristina packs her older son’s lunch for preschool every morning.

School lunch ideas + printable lunch notes from Good On Paper Design | 100 Layer Cakelet

On the menu today? A seedy sourdough rye bagel & cream cheese from the local farmer’s market, homemade strawberry greek yogurt, apple and pluot slices, and a babybel cheese. There are so many variations you can make though. LunchBots and Weelicious have a ton of really great ideas!
